Buying Guide
Choosing the right harness for your German Shepherd involves considering several factors. Here’s what to keep in mind:
- Size and Fit: Measure your dog’s chest and neck girth to ensure a proper fit. A harness that’s too tight can be uncomfortable, while one that’s too loose can be unsafe.
- Material and Durability: Look for harnesses made from durable materials like nylon or canvas. The hardware (buckles, rings, and clips) should be sturdy and rust-resistant.
- Comfort: Padded chest and belly straps can prevent chafing and discomfort, especially during long walks. Breathable mesh lining can also help keep your dog cool.
- Leash Attachment Points: Consider whether you prefer a front-clip or back-clip harness. Front-clip harnesses are effective for reducing pulling, while back-clip harnesses are better for relaxed walks. Some harnesses offer both options.
- Adjustability: Adjustable straps allow you to customize the fit of the harness, ensuring a secure and comfortable fit.
- Intended Use: Think about the activities you’ll be using the harness for. If you plan on hiking or training, a more durable and feature-rich harness may be necessary.
FAQs
Q: What is the best type of harness for a German Shepherd who pulls?
A: A front-clip harness, like the PetSafe Easy Walk, is generally the most effective for reducing pulling. It redirects your dog’s attention back to you when they pull, making it easier to control them.
Q: How do I measure my German Shepherd for a harness?
A: Use a soft measuring tape to measure your dog’s chest girth (around the widest part of their chest, behind their front legs) and neck girth (around the base of their neck). Refer to the harness manufacturer’s sizing chart to determine the appropriate size.
Q: Are harnesses better than collars for German Shepherds?
A: Harnesses are generally considered safer and more comfortable than collars, especially for large breeds like German Shepherds. They distribute pressure more evenly across the body, reducing the risk of neck injuries. However, collars are still useful for attaching ID tags.
Q: How often should I replace my dog’s harness?
A: It depends on the quality of the harness and how frequently you use it. Inspect the harness regularly for signs of wear and tear, such as frayed straps, broken buckles, or loose stitching. Replace the harness if you notice any damage.
Q: Can I leave a harness on my German Shepherd all day?
A: It’s generally not recommended to leave a harness on your dog all day, as it can cause chafing and discomfort. Remove the harness when you’re not actively using it.
